Andris K. Berzins is a visionary leader and Managing Partner at Change Ventures, the first and largest pan-Baltic pre-seed and seed fund that specializes in backing ambitious Baltic founders on a global scale. With a keen eye for potential and the perseverance it takes to succeed, Change Ventures has supported a variety of innovative startups, investing in notable companies such as Interactio, Nordigen, Aerones, Giraffe360, Planet42, Memby, Dogo, INZMO, and Printify. A proud member of the Kauffman Fellows Class 22, Andris has demonstrated a relentless commitment to fostering entrepreneurship in the Baltic region and beyond.
Andris' career in technology startups spans over 15 years, with significant experience in both the United States and Europe. His journey began after he completed his MBA in Global Management at Stanford University Graduate School of Business, during the economically dynamic pre-dot-com boom. Following that, he honed his strategic and analytical skills at Bain & Company, a prestigious strategy consulting firm. His strong foundation in technology and business soon propelled him to executive roles in various startups, where he made significant contributions to their growth. As CMO at Bookatable, which was often referred to as "The OpenTable of Europe", Andris played a pivotal role in leading the company to a successful $110M acquisition by Michelin. Additionally, he served as Vice President at AeroScout, where he contributed to the company's innovative enterprise WiFi location solutions until their $240M exit to Stanley, Black & Decker.
Andris's multifaceted experience not only includes startup leadership but also roles within venture capital, having partnered with firms such as Creandum. His passion for entrepreneurship and startup ecosystems led him to co-found TechHub Riga, a vital hub that kick-started the startup community in Latvia. This establishment is credited for setting up the leading co-working space in the city and initiating the widely popular annual TechChill conference, which serves as a platform for collaboration and innovation among aspiring entrepreneurs.
Education and Achievements
Andris K. Berzins's educational journey is as impressive as his professional accomplishments. He holds an MBA in Global Management from the prestigious Stanford University Graduate School of Business, where he developed a robust understanding of global business dynamics, strategic thinking, and innovation management. His undergraduate background includes a BSc (Hons) in Management from City, University of London, equipping him with a firm foundation in business principles.
Beyond his formal education, Andris's accolades and contributions to the industry have been recognized by numerous entities. His dedication to developing the startup ecosystem in Latvia earned him the Human Development Award presented by the President of Latvia, acknowledging his outstanding contributions to the nation's future through his work with startups and TechHub Riga.

In addition to his role as Managing Partner at Change Ventures, Andris has held various positions in the startup and venture capital landscape, showcasing his extensive expertise. Some of his notable previous roles include:
- Former Investor at Printify, Memby, and Dogo - your dog's favorite app, indicating his commitment to supporting diverse industries.
- Board Observer for organizations like Algori, Aerones, Giraffe360, and HumansApp, where he added strategic insights and oversight.
- Chairman of the Board for Nordigen and Interactio, showcasing his leadership capabilities.
- Investment Advisor at SmartCap, further demonstrating his proficiency in venture capital.
Andris is not only a prolific investor and advisor but also a sought-after speaker at various conferences, regularly sharing his insights and knowledge on entrepreneurship and innovation. Additionally, he engages in mentoring up-and-coming startups through programs like Seedcamp, Startup Wise Guys, and Startup Sauna, reflecting his dedication to nurturing the next generation of founders.
His community involvement extends to collaborations with several Ministers for Economics and the Prime Ministers of Latvia, where he has been a valuable resource for advice on developing the startup ecosystem.
Furthermore, Andris has proven his ability to lead and innovate through his previous roles as CEO at BuzzTale, Chief Commercial Officer at Walkbase, and Vice President and Managing Director at AeroScout, among others, all contributing to his status as an industry leader.
